 #ifndef AVCODEC_V4L2_M2M_H
 #define AVCODEC_V4L2_M2M_H
 
 #include <semaphore.h>
 #include <unistd.h>
 #include <dirent.h>

 #include "libavcodec/avcodec.h"
 #include "v4l2_context.h"
 
 #define container_of(ptr, type, member) ({ \
         const __typeof__(((type *)0)->member ) *__mptr = (ptr); \
         (type *)((char *)__mptr - offsetof(type,member) );})
 
 #define V4L_M2M_DEFAULT_OPTS \
     { "num_output_buffers", "Number of buffers in the output context",\
         OFFSET(output.num_buffers), AV_OPT_TYPE_INT, { .i64 = 16 }, 6, INT_MAX, FLAGS }
 
 typedef struct V4L2m2mContext
 {
     AVClass *class;
     char devname[PATH_MAX];
     int fd;
 
     /* the codec context queues */
     V4L2Context capture;
     V4L2Context output;
 
     /* refcount of buffers held by the user */
     atomic_uint refcount;
 
     /* dynamic stream reconfig */
     AVCodecContext *avctx;
     sem_t refsync;
     int reinit;
 
     /* null frame/packet received */
     int draining;
 } V4L2m2mContext;
 
 /**
  * Probes the video nodes looking for the required codec capabilities.
  *
  * @param[in] ctx The AVCodecContext instantiated by the encoder/decoder.
  *
  * @returns 0 if a driver is found, a negative number otherwise.
  */
 int ff_v4l2_m2m_codec_init(AVCodecContext *avctx);
 
 /**
  * Releases all the codec resources if all AVBufferRefs have been returned to the
  * ctx. Otherwise keep the driver open.
  *
  * @param[in] The AVCodecContext instantiated by the encoder/decoder.
  *
  * @returns 0
  *
  */
 int ff_v4l2_m2m_codec_end(AVCodecContext *avctx);
 
 /**
